Sourcing guidance for Wholesale Fruit Seed
What are the key quality indicators to look for when sourcing wholesale fruit seeds?
When sourcing fruit seeds, the most critical factors are germination rate, genetic purity, and moisture content. You should demand a germination rate of at least 85-90% for most commercial fruit varieties. Ensure the seeds are true-to-type (genetically pure) to avoid unexpected variations in fruit quality. Additionally, seeds must be stored at a moisture level below 10% to prevent mold and maintain long-term viability during cross-border transit.
Which international compliance standards and certifications are mandatory for fruit seeds?
Agricultural products are highly regulated. You must ensure the supplier provides a Phytosanitary Certificate issued by the exporting country's national plant protection organization. For organic markets, look for USDA Organic or EU Organic certifications. Furthermore, verify that the seeds comply with ISTA (International Seed Testing Association) standards, which provide globally recognized protocols for seed sampling and testing.
How should packaging and storage be handled for bulk seed shipments?
To maintain seed health, use vacuum-sealed aluminum foil bags or moisture-proof multi-layer packaging. For long-distance shipping, temperature-controlled containers (reefers) are recommended, especially for tropical fruit seeds that are sensitive to extreme heat. The packaging must be clearly labeled with the lot number, expiration date, and treatment status (e.g., whether they are treated with fungicides).
What technical specifications are important for commercial-scale fruit cultivation?
Buyers should inquire about disease resistance profiles (e.g., resistance to common wilts or viruses) and climatic adaptability. Request data on the expected yield per hectare and the maturity duration. If you are sourcing for specific industrial uses, check the Brix level (sugar content) and shelf-life characteristics of the resulting fruit to ensure they meet your end-market requirements.
Cross-Border Purchasing Risks and Strategies for Fruit Seeds
What are the primary risks when importing seeds from overseas suppliers?
The biggest risk is customs seizure or destruction due to non-compliance with local invasive species laws or lack of proper documentation. To mitigate this, always check your country's National Plant Protection Organization (NPPO) database for prohibited species. Another risk is loss of viability during shipping; always include a clause in your contract regarding compensation for low germination rates verified by a third-party lab upon arrival.
How can I negotiate better terms with seed suppliers on Made-in-China.com?
Focus on volume-based pricing and long-term supply stability. For initial orders, request a paid sample pack to test germination before committing to a bulk purchase. Negotiate for staggered shipments if you have limited cold-storage capacity. Professional buyers often secure a 5-10% discount by providing a seasonal forecast, which helps the supplier manage their harvest and processing schedule.
What transaction security measures should be taken for large seed orders?
Always use secure payment methods that offer escrow services or trade assurance. For high-value orders, consider using a Letter of Credit (L/C) to ensure payment is only released upon the presentation of valid shipping and phytosanitary documents. Conduct third-party inspections (such as SGS or Intertek) at the supplier's warehouse to verify the quantity and packaging integrity before the container is sealed.
What is the best shipping method for maintaining seed quality to international destinations?
For high-value or sensitive seeds, Air Freight is preferred to minimize the time spent in uncontrolled environments. For bulk orders where cost is a factor, Sea Freight in refrigerated containers is the standard. Ensure the Incoterms are clearly defined; CIF (Cost, Insurance, and Freight) is often preferred for beginners as the seller handles the complex logistics and insurance, but FOB (Free On Board) gives experienced buyers more control over the shipping environment and costs.
